Re: ruby support for vim & gvim 7.3

On 10/3/2011 10:35 PM, beaucoder wrote:
Hi Vimmers,  Using Ubuntu Lucid 10.04 with vim & gvim 7.3 (Mercurial source from vim.org and then compiled on Ubuntu 10.04.)  The challenge:     1. How to compile vim & gvim 7.3 WITH ruby support? Is there a compiler setting? Switch? Dependencies?     2. Which vim scripts to use? I have rails.vim in ~/.vim/plugin, rails.vim & rubycomplete.vim in ~/.vim/autoload.     4. Getting the ruby & rails vim-scripts for syntax, highlighting and autocomplete to work with vim & gvim 7.3.   
if you're compiling it yourself, you just need to tell configure to include ruby in the build

./configure --help

..snip
  --enable-rubyinterp=OPTS     Include Ruby interpreter.  default=no OPTS=no/yes/dynamic
...snip...

you'll need the ruby dev packages for ubuntu also
